I am trying to set some far future expiration on my files in a bucket on S3, using this python code:
future = 60*60*24*666
future_date = datetime.now() + timedelta(seconds=future)
future_date = future_date.strftime("%a, %d %b %Y %H:%M:%S GMT")
# and further down in file:
f = open(src)
s3.put(key, f.read())
s3.copy("%s/%s" % (bucket, key), key, metadata={
"Cache-control": "max-age=%d" % future,
"Expires": future_date})
However, when I investigate the files in firebug they do not have neither Expires och Cache-control. Instead there are prefixed versions of the metadata.
x-amz-meta-cache-control max-age=57542400
x-amz-meta-expires Thu, 15 May 2014 01:03:25 GMT
I would highly appreciate to set metadata and skip the "-x-amz-" prefixes.

Hi,
When you issue 2 put_file request with different file size, the header content-length is stuck at the size of the first file, causing a 400 return code from server due to the invalid content-length.
To reproduce the issue :
f_path = 'tmp'
with open(f_path, 'wb') as f:
f.write("toto")
s3.put_file(f_path, f_path)
with open(f_path, 'wb') as f:
f.write("toto2")
s3.put_file(f_path, f_path)
Tested against RADOS GATEWAY.
The root cause is due to the fact that is header param is empty when calling put_file, a default dict is assigned in the function definition. https://github.com/lericson/simples3/blob/master/simples3/streaming.py#L34
As a result, every subsequent call will get the same object reference (as the dict is in the class scope and not function scope).
Content-length will always be set after the first call, as a result it is not updated
https://github.com/lericson/simples3/blob/master/simples3/streaming.py#L58

The current implementation of RFC 822 formatting uses just time.strftime()
function, and the formatter for it, defined in simples3.util.rfc822_fmt
, is '%a, %d %b %Y %H:%M:%S GMT'
. According to the documentation of time.strftime()
:
%a
: Locale’s abbreviated weekday name.
%b
: Locale’s abbreviated month name.
As a result, the current RFC 822 formatting is broken in non-US locale (e.g. ko_KR
, ja_JP
). You can reproduce it easily:
>>> import time
>>> t = time.gmtime()
>>> time.strftime('%a, %d %b %Y %H:%M:%S GMT', t)
'Wed, 30 Nov 2011 08:29:14 GMT'
>>> import locale
>>> locale.setlocale(locale.LC_ALL, 'ko_KR')
'ko_KR'
>>> time.strftime('%a, %d %b %Y %H:%M:%S GMT', t)
'\xec\x88\x98, 30 11 2011 08:29:14 GMT'
>>> print _
수, 30 11 2011 08:29:14 GMT
>>> locale.setlocale(locale.LC_ALL, 'ja_JP')
'ja_JP'
>>> time.strftime('%a, %d %b %Y %H:%M:%S GMT', t)
'\xe6\xb0\xb4, 30 11 2011 08:29:14 GMT'
>>> print _
水, 30 11 2011 08:29:14 GMT
This bug also produces incorrect signatures (used for AWS authentication).
